• slider image 442
  • slider image 492
  • slider image 493
  • slider image 494
  • slider image 495
  • slider image 496
  • slider image 488
  • slider image 491
:::


Browsing this Thread:   1 Anonymous Users






Re: 請問有人有燒錄PIC18的程式範例嗎?
#6
高級會員
高級會員


查看用戶資訊
PIC18F的燒錄的確是很複雜
(如果你做過dsPIC, 就不會覺得太難, dsPIC超難的)

Configuration Words 的設定是一定要放在程式裡,
否則HEX檔裏根本沒有Configuration的資料

發表於: 2007/8/2 16:48
Twitter Facebook Google Plus Linkedin Del.icio.us Digg Reddit Mr. Wong 頂部


Re: 請問有人有燒錄PIC18的程式範例嗎?
#5
版主
版主


查看用戶資訊
A. 只要有 HEX 檔就可以燒錄,像眾多燒錄器的廠商也接受HEX檔的燒錄。MPLAB IDE 下操作 : 1. 先選好 Device 。2. 在Files 底下選擇 IMPORT 輸入你所需要的HEX檔。 3. View 底下打開Program 看看程式碼有沒有進來也可以用反組譯的方式顯示。 4. Check Configuration Words 的設定是否正確。5. 用Programming Mode 燒錄程式。

B. Configuration Words 的設定最好是放在程式裡,不管是組語或是 Hi-Tech PICC C18 都可以直接設定 (含 ID & EEPROM Data) 。編譯過後 Configuration Value 會以HEX的方式跟著你的檔案一起跑,只要 Import HEX 進來,Configuration 的設定就跟著設定完成。

C. PIC的HEX有三種,MPASM及C在編譯時會自動選擇,MPLAB IDE 也會自動選擇。但使用協力廠可能要注意一下 HEX 的格式。

發表於: 2007/8/2 9:41
Twitter Facebook Google Plus Linkedin Del.icio.us Digg Reddit Mr. Wong 頂部


Re: 請問有人有燒錄PIC18的程式範例嗎?
#4
資深會員
資深會員


查看用戶資訊
我也是比較相信 ICD2
不過還必須帶台電腦出門,有點麻煩...

另外有一點就是
我不知道用MPLAB燒錄PIC時
是否一定要經過程式碼編譯的過程
是否可以直接載入一個燒錄檔而不必擁有原始程式碼
如果可以的話
載入那個燒錄檔時
組態設定是否會跟著改?

發表於: 2007/8/2 8:35
木亟缶夬金戔
彳艮缶夬金戔
走召缶夬金戔
Twitter Facebook Google Plus Linkedin Del.icio.us Digg Reddit Mr. Wong 頂部


Re: 請問有人有燒錄PIC18的程式範例嗎?
#3
版主
版主


查看用戶資訊
我看還是帶個ICD2來燒錄比較方便,除非你有特殊的用途。
PIC18F 的燒錄比較複雜,一定要遵循 Programming Specification 的燒錄命令與指令。

發表於: 2007/7/30 17:46
Twitter Facebook Google Plus Linkedin Del.icio.us Digg Reddit Mr. Wong 頂部


Re: 請問有人有燒錄PIC18的程式範例嗎?
#2
高級會員
高級會員


查看用戶資訊
理論上只需帶個有新程式的記憶裝置
跟小型燒錄器就可以了是吧?!
ans:是的,

請問PIC18系列的各顆PIC燒錄規格都不相同嗎?
我在美國網站上看到好幾個燒錄規範說明擋
ANS: 有幾種燒錄規格檔, 自己找一下, 內容都有列出可以燒哪幾顆
燒錄規格檔裡面也有燒錄流程圖,時序圖,燒錄程序......, 應該很清楚了

我現在先要試PIC18F8621
在進入高電壓燒錄模式時
必須把PGC跟PGD拉低準位
再把VPP拉到12V左右
那燒錄過程VPP都要一直維持在12V嗎?
ANS:是的

而低電壓模式則只要5V就好
可是卻必須再控制PGM這隻腳喔?
ans:是的

舊型PIC好像沒有低電壓燒錄模式
那還是先學高電壓燒錄好了...
ans:ICD2 也只用高壓模式, 高壓模式的解說感覺也比較清楚, 所以先學高壓是對的

發表於: 2007/7/28 14:44
Twitter Facebook Google Plus Linkedin Del.icio.us Digg Reddit Mr. Wong 頂部


請問有人有燒錄PIC18的程式範例嗎?
#1
資深會員
資深會員


查看用戶資訊
最近研發工作比較閒
所以想說來試試自製燒錄器
這樣以後業務要出門更新程式時
理論上只需帶個有新程式的記憶裝置
跟小型燒錄器就可以了是吧?!
更高階的只要機器接上網就可以自己更新韌體了(BOOTLOADER ?)

請問PIC18系列的各顆PIC燒錄規格都不相同嗎?
我在美國網站上看到好幾個燒錄規範說明擋
我現在先要試PIC18F8621
在進入高電壓燒錄模式時
必須把PGC跟PGD拉低準位
再把VPP拉到12V左右
那燒錄過程VPP都要一直維持在12V嗎?
而低電壓模式則只要5V就好
可是卻必須再控制PGM這隻腳喔?

舊型PIC好像沒有低電壓燒錄模式
那還是先學高電壓燒錄好了...

發表於: 2007/7/28 8:57
木亟缶夬金戔
彳艮缶夬金戔
走召缶夬金戔
Twitter Facebook Google Plus Linkedin Del.icio.us Digg Reddit Mr. Wong 頂部







You can view topic.
不可以 發起新主題
You cannot reply to posts.
You cannot edit your posts.
You cannot delete your posts.
You cannot add new polls.
You cannot vote in polls.
You cannot attach files to posts.
You cannot post without approval.
You cannot use topic type.
You cannot use HTML syntax.
You cannot use signature.
You cannot create PDF files.
You cannot get print page.

[進階搜尋]


:::

Microchip連結

https://www.facebook.com/microchiptechnologytaiwan/
http://www.microchip.com.tw/modules/tad_uploader/index.php?of_cat_sn=13
https://mu.microchip.com/page/tmu
http://elearning.microchip.com.tw/modules/tad_link/index.php?cate_sn=1
https://page.microchip.com/APAC-PrefCenters-TW.html
http://www.microchip.com/
http://www.microchip.com/treelink
http://www.microchipdirect.com/
http://www.microchip.com.cn/newcommunity/index.php?m=Video&a=index&id=103
http://www.microchip.com.tw/modules/tad_uploader/index.php?of_cat_sn=2
http://www.microchip.com.tw/Data_CD/eLearning/index.html
http://www.microchip.com.tw/RTC/RTC_DVD/
https://www.microchip.com/development-tools/
https://www.youtube.com/user/MicrochipTechnology
[ more... ]

教育訓練中心

!開發工具購買
辦法說明 [業界客戶] [教育單位]
----------------------------------
!校園樣品申請
辦法說明 [教師資格] [學生資格]
----------------------------------